Rotherham United vs. Sunderland Preview

The Championship stage is set for an exciting encounter as bottom-placed Rotherham United take on high-flying Sunderland at the AESSEAL New York Stadium. This Friday’s clash has immense implications for both sides, with Rotherham desperately fighting for survival and Sunderland chasing a coveted playoff spot.

Rotherham: The Millers find themselves firmly entrenched at the foot of the table, plagued by inconsistency and defensive problems. However, a ray of hope emerged last week with a surprise victory over Middlesbrough, which reignited their relegation fight. Paul Warne’s men know that nothing less than three points will do, and they demand a full-throttle performance fueled by desperation and home advantage.

Sunderland: The Black Cats have soared under Tony Mowbray and currently occupy a comfortable mid-table position with much higher ambitions. Their attacking prowess, led by the in-form Ellis Simms, has terrorized defenses of late, and they will be eager to maintain their momentum against struggling Rotherham. However, complacency could prove costly and underestimating the Millers’ fighting spirit would be a mistake.
